Biochemical characteristics of rosehip genotypes (fresh weight base)_

GenotypesAntioxidant activity (DPPH) (mmol TE · kg−1)Total flavonoids (mg QE · kg−1)Total phenolics (mg GAE · kg−1)
G146.777 ± 0.145 n523.20 ± 5.41 jk63,495.40 ± 230.94 ih
G246.462 ± 0.204 n708.40 ± 3.91 g63,452.80 ± 255.46 ih
G351.042 ± 0.139 k517.40 ± 4.47 jk71,282.80 ± 256.12 d
G452.186 ± 0.128 j500.80 ± 6.18 kl67,119.80 ± 229.01 f
G551.334 ± 0.280 k402.20 ± 4.28 o48,936.20 ± 147.12 n
G639.510 ± 0.172 o615.40 ± 5.94 h39,103.20 ± 135.65 s
G748.791 ± 0.321 lm287.80 ± 6.53 r41,221.40 ± 235.79 r
G864.726 ± 0.227 c560.00 ± 3.82 i63,220.00 ± 477.88 i
G955.626 ± 0.209 h480.80 ± 6.73 l50,449.80 ± 443.70 m
G1061.904 ± 0.234 d629.20 ± 9.56 h57,572.20 ± 443.72 j
G1146.446 ± 0.355 n292.80 ± 1.77 r38,519.40 ± 95.26 s
G1246.958 ± 0.243 n452.60 ± 0.92 m39,297.40 ± 323.95 s
G1352.887 ± 0.203 i342.20 ± 3.15 p46,377.80 ± 283.56 o
G1456.329 ± 0.292 g407.80 ± 2.59 no45,989.00 ± 454.78 o
G1558.241 ± 0.205 f726.80 ± 5.90 g58,534.00 ± 291.88 j
G1653.422 ± 0.227 i431.60 ± 4.84 mn44,822.20 ± 90.64 p
G1756.142 ± 0.172 gh985.20 ± 12.41 d56,139.40 ± 326.93 k
G1859.361 ± 0.273 e1,686.20 ± 4.55 a62,851.80 ± 304.91 i
G1972.673 ± 0.198 a1,505.20 ± 35.01 b79,080.60 ± 267.63 a
G2067.944 ± 0.316 b1,095.80 ± 10.00 c73,391.60 ± 455.63 b
G2148.318 ± 0.160 m754.40 ± 4.05 f68,647.00 ± 272.68 e
G2259.838 ± 0.257 e537.60 ± 3.73 ij64,285.20 ± 894.97 gh
G2349.226 ± 0.163 l533.60 ± 5.11 ij52,998.00 ± 177.86 l
G2464.864 ± 0.173 c636.60 ± 7.29 h72,313.20 ± 252.59 c
G2567.705 ± 0.243 b864.80 ± 4.07 e64,672.60 ± 253.87 g
